How Much Power Does a 5000-Watt Generator Actually Provide?
Many people assume that a 5000W generator can simply power any appliance with a rating below 5000-Watts. In reality, generators have two different power ratings that should always be considered before connecting electrical equipment.
- Running watts refer to the continuous power a generator can supply during normal operation.
- Starting watts (also called surge watts) are the short bursts of additional power required when motor-driven appliances switch on.
Appliances such as refrigerators, freezers, sump pumps and portable air conditioners often draw two to three times their normal running wattage for a few seconds during start-up. If several of these appliances start simultaneously, the combined surge demand may exceed the generator’s capacity even though the normal running load appears well within the limit.
For this reason, it’s always good practice to leave some spare capacity rather than operating a generator at its maximum output. Keeping the continuous load below around 80% of the rated capacity not only reduces the risk of overload but can also improve fuel efficiency and extend the generator’s service life.
What Can Run on a 5000-Watt Generator?
Now let’s answer the question most buyers have: what can run on a 5000-Watt generator?
A generator of this size is capable of powering a broad selection of household appliances, communication equipment, kitchen devices and outdoor tools. While some high-demand appliances require careful load management, most everyday electrical items fall comfortably within its operating range.
| Appliance | Running Watts | Starting Watts (Approx.) | Suitable? |
|---|---|---|---|
| Refrigerator | 100–800W | 500–2,000W | ✅ Yes |
| Freezer | 300–700W | 1,000–2,000W | ✅ Yes |
| LED Lighting | 10–100W | Same as running watts | ✅ Yes |
| Broadband Router | 10–30W | Same as running watts | ✅ Yes |
| Television | 50–200W | Same as running watts | ✅ Yes |
| Laptop | 50–100W | Same as running watts | ✅ Yes |
| Mobile Phone Charger | 5–30W | Same as running watts | ✅ Yes |
| Microwave | 600–1,500W | Same as running watts | ✅ Yes |
| Coffee Machine | 800–1,500W | Same as running watts | ✅ Yes |
| Electric Kettle | 2,000–3,000W | Same as running watts | ✅ Usually |
| Portable Air Conditioner | 1,000–1,800W | 2,000–3,000W | ✅ Usually |
| Circular Saw | 1,200–2,000W | 2,000–4,000W | ✅ Usually |
| Air Compressor | 1,500–2,500W | 3,000–5,000W | Depends |
| Electric Heater | 1,500–3,000W | Same as running watts | Limited |
| Central Air Conditioner | 3,000W+ | 5,000W+ | Depends |
Although these figures provide a useful guide, every appliance is different. Always check the manufacturer’s specifications before connecting high-power equipment, particularly anything with an electric motor or compressor.
What Can You Run on a 5000-Watt Generator at the Same Time?
Understanding what can you run on a 5000-Watt generator is often more useful than looking at individual appliances. In practice, you’ll normally power several devices together rather than using only one at a time.
Below are three typical scenarios that demonstrate how a 5000W generator may be used.
Example 1: Home Emergency Backup
During a power cut, most households only need to keep essential appliances running.
| Appliance | Running Watts |
|---|---|
| Refrigerator | 200W |
| Broadband Router | 20W |
| Television | 120W |
| Six LED Lights | 80W |
| Laptop | 60W |
| Mobile Phone Chargers | 20W |
Estimated Running Load: 500W
This leaves plenty of spare capacity for occasional use of a microwave or coffee machine while maintaining reliable operation.
Example 2: Camping and Caravan
For caravan holidays or extended camping trips, a 5000W generator can comfortably support everyday comforts.
| Appliance | Running Watts |
|---|---|
| Portable Fridge | 80W |
| Electric Kettle | 2,200W |
| Coffee Machine | 1,000W |
| Lighting | 60W |
| Phone & Laptop Charging | 120W |
Estimated Running Load: 3,460W
This setup remains within the capacity of a typical 5000W generator, although it’s still advisable not to operate every appliance continuously.
Appliances a 5000-Watt Generator May Not Run
A common misconception is that a 5000W generator can power every appliance in a home. In reality, some electrical equipment requires more power than a portable generator of this size can safely provide.
The table below highlights appliances that may exceed the generator’s capacity or require careful load management.
| Appliance | Can It Run? | Notes |
|---|---|---|
| Electric Shower | ❌ No | Typically requires 7–10kW. |
| Electric Oven | ⚠️ Limited | May only power one heating element at a time. |
| Electric Hob | ⚠️ Limited | High continuous power demand. |
| Heat Pump | Usually No | High startup current. |
| Central Air Conditioner | Depends | Larger units often exceed surge capacity. |
| Electric Water Heater | Usually No | High continuous load. |
| Tumble Dryer | Depends | Heating element and motor draw significant power. |
This doesn’t necessarily mean these appliances can never be used. If they’re the only device connected and their startup demand falls within the generator’s limits, some models may operate successfully. However, trying to run several high-power appliances together is likely to exceed the available output.
For most households, prioritising essential appliances is a far more practical approach than attempting whole-home backup.

How to Choose the Right Backup Power Solution
Choosing the right power source isn’t simply about selecting the highest wattage. The best option depends on how and where you plan to use it.
Estimate Your Essential Load
Start by listing the appliances you expect to use during a power cut or outdoor trip. Add together their running wattage and check the startup requirements of any motor-driven equipment.
Leave Room for Startup Surges
Avoid operating your generator at full capacity. Leaving around 20% spare capacity helps accommodate temporary startup loads while improving reliability.
Think About Runtime
A generator’s wattage determines what it can power, while its fuel tank or battery capacity determines how long it can keep those appliances running.
Choose the Right Technology
If you regularly require high-output power for heavy-duty equipment, a petrol generator remains a practical choice. If your priorities are quiet operation, minimal maintenance and solar charging, a portable power station may provide a better long-term solution.
FAQs
Can a 5000-Watt generator run a fridge freezer?
Yes. Most domestic fridge freezers require between 100W and 300W while running, although the compressor may briefly demand several times that amount during start-up. A 5000W generator can usually handle this without difficulty.
Can you boil a kettle with a 5000-Watt generator?
In most cases, yes. Electric kettles typically consume between 2,000W and 3,000W, so a 5000W generator has sufficient capacity. However, avoid using several other high-power appliances at the same time.
Is a 5000-Watt generator enough during a power cut?
For most households, yes. It can usually power essential appliances such as refrigeration, lighting, broadband equipment, televisions and charging devices. Large heating appliances and whole-house backup generally require a higher-capacity system.
How long will a petrol generator run?
Runtime depends on fuel tank size, engine efficiency and electrical load. Many portable petrol generators can operate for around 8–12 hours on a full tank under moderate load, although actual runtime varies between models.
